The equation Ax = 0 has no free variables, so A has n pivot columns. Since A is square, the pivots must be on the main diagonal, so A is row equivalent to the n x n identity matrix Iₙ.
In order for the equation Ax = 0 to have only the trivial solution, there must be no free variables. This means that the matrix A must have n pivot columns. Since A is square, the n pivot positions must be in different rows, which means that the pivots must be on the main diagonal. This means that A is row equivalent to the n x n identity matrix Iₙ. suppose we flip four coins simultaneously: a penny, a nickel, a dime, and a quarter. what is the probability that they all come up heads?
The probability that all four coins come up heads is 1/16 or approximately 0.0625.
The probability of flipping a head on a single coin is 1/2. Since each coin is flipped independently, the probability of all four coins coming up heads can be calculated by multiplying the probability of getting heads on each coin.
That is,
P(all heads) = P(heads on penny) × P(heads on nickel) × P(heads on dime) × P(heads on quarter)
Each of these probabilities is 1/2 since each coin has two possible outcomes – heads or tails – and they are equally likely to occur.
Thus,
P(all heads) = (1/2) × (1/2) × (1/2) × (1/2) = 1/16
This means that if we were to flip these four coins many times, on average we would expect to see all four coins come up heads about once in every 16 flips. It is important to note that the probability of all four coins coming up heads is independent of any previous flips – the coins do not "remember" whether they landed heads or tails on previous flips.

Find an equation of the parabola described and state the two points that define the latus rectum. Focus at (0,3); directrix the line y=-3 A) x2 = 16y; latus rectum: (8, 3) and (-8,3) C) x2 = 12y; latus rectum: (6, 3) and (-6, 3) B) x2 = 12y; latus rectum: (3, 6) and (-3, 6) D) y2 = 16x; latus rectum: (7,8) and (-7,8)
The equation of parabola is x² = 12y and the endpoints of the latus rectum are (-6, 3) and (6, 3).
Hence the correct option is (C).
We know that for parabola, any point on parabola is equidistance from the directrix and the focus.
Given that the focus of the required parabola is = (0, 3)
The directrix is y = -3.
Let the locus of the point on parabola be (h, k).
The distance between (h, k) and (0, 3) = √((h - 0)² + (k - 3)²) = √(h² + (k - 3)²)
The distance of the point (h, k) from y = -3 is = k + 3.
According to properties,
k + 3 = √(h² + (k - 3)²)
(k + 3)² = h² + (k - 3)²
k² + 6k + 9 = h² + k² - 6k + 9
h² = 12k
Since (h, k) is an arbitrary point.
So the equation of the parabola is, x² = 12y
We know that the endpoints of the latus rectum of parabola x² = 4ay are given by (2a, a) and (-2a, a).
Here a = 3.
So the endpoints of the latus rectum are (6, 3) and (-6, 3).
Hence the correct option is (C).
